About Sunil K. Agrawal

Sunil K. Agrawal is a scholar working on Physical Therapy, Sports Therapy and Rehabilitation, Rehabilitation and Control and Systems Engineering, having authored 524 papers that have together received 11.3k indexed citations. Recurring topics across this work include Prosthetics and Rehabilitation Robotics (120 papers), Stroke Rehabilitation and Recovery (99 papers), Muscle activation and electromyography studies (96 papers), Robotic Mechanisms and Dynamics (83 papers), Control and Dynamics of Mobile Robots (73 papers), Cerebral Palsy and Movement Disorders (72 papers), Balance, Gait, and Falls Prevention (64 papers) and Robotic Locomotion and Control (54 papers). The work is most often cited by research in Rehabilitation (2.7k citations), Physical Therapy, Sports Therapy and Rehabilitation (959 citations) and Control and Systems Engineering (4.1k citations). Sunil K. Agrawal has collaborated with scholars based in United States, Italy and China. Frequent co-authors include Sai K. Banala, So-Ryeok Oh, John P. Scholz, Ying Mao, Abbas Fattah, Damiano Zanotto, Kaustubh Pathak, Seok Hun Kim, Zaeem A. Khan and Jaume Franch.
